Megastar Chiranjeevi’s much-awaited fantasy film Vishwambhara, directed by Bimbisara fame Mallidi Vasishta, appears to be caught in a strange silence. Though most of the shooting is reportedly completed, there has been no official update on its release or promotional plans.
Interestingly, Chiranjeevi has already moved on to shooting for his next film with director Anil Ravipudi, which is progressing swiftly. Trisha Krishnan stars opposite him in Vishwambhara, and Bollywood actor Kunal Kapoor plays the main antagonist, with Rao Ramesh in a key role.
Sources reveal that a few scenes are being re-shot, and post-production is still underway, particularly in the VFX department. After releasing a teaser last year, the makers also dropped a song a few weeks ago. However, the visuals in the teaser received criticism online for subpar graphics. Since then, UV Creations, the film’s producers, have remained tight-lipped, reportedly working hard to enhance the visual effects.
Adding to the excitement is the return of legendary music composer MM Keeravani, who is scoring for a Chiranjeevi film after a long gap.
